Our 70th Annual Meeting of the Cherokee County Chamber of Commerce will be held on Thursday evening April 21st beginning at 6:00pm in the Gadsden State Cherokee Arena.  

This year's entertainment, 
Hypnotist Mark Maverick is being sponsored by the
Cherokee County Industrial Development Authority.  

Chamber Annual Awards will be 
presented and a meal served. 

Tickets must be purchased by April 15th.  Individual $30.00, Table of six $175, Table of eight $225.

Our Mission Statement Is:


The purpose of the Cherokee County Chamber of Commerce is to stimulate, promote, advance and improve the infrastructure for business, industry, tourism, and civic endeavors of Cherokee County.
